33,605,450 is a composite number, even.
33,605,450 (thirty-three million six hundred five thousand four hundred fifty) is an even 8-digit number. It is a composite number with 24 divisors, and factors as 2 × 5² × 439 × 1,531. Written other ways, in hexadecimal, 0x200C74A.
